College Art Association Conference
The College Art Association Conference, in its 114th year in 2026, features a Book Fair at which NAWA has sponsored a booth for the past four years. This year the Conference occurred in Chicago, where there were 150 interactions at our booth.
On Friday, February 20, 2026, NAWA Honorary Vice President Gail Levin held a book sale and signing at the NAWA booth of her just-released biography of Alice Baber. [Ed. Note: See related article in this issue].
Baber’s art and name were suppressed in the past, but Levin has researched and revived Baber’s story in this new book. She had work in the Metropolitan Museum of Art, the Whitney, and many galleries as an abstract expressionist in 1950’s-1980’s New York City. I have started reading this volume and recommend it highly for Alice Baber’s story and its value as another glimpse into the art scene of that era, including the downtown scene, Cedar Tavern intrigue, and more.
Meanwhile, back at the NAWA booth, NAWA Historian Susan Rostan and I spoke to artists, professors, writers and art historians, collecting names and emails, especially promoting the upcoming build-out of the writer membership category (stay tuned). Many attendees already knew about NAWA, but most did not, so this is a wonderful way to expand NAWA visibility.

Art Angels
NAWA member volunteers are racking up those hours. Additional sponsorship is sought so we might have the Art Angels Exhibit in-person and perhaps help artists with shipping costs. The American Spirit Company has agreed to continue sponsoring the Art Angels, so it will definitely be happening with no entry fee, as before. This exhibit is a “thank you” to those member volunteers who donate a minimum of 16 hours of their time and report it to the office or submit on Bloomerang Volunteer.
Exhibitions
NAWA is booked with exhibitions for 2026 and booking into 2027 and 2028 now. The Sasse Museum in Pomona, CA exhibit, Pacific Influence, came off beautifully with good reviews and one sale (see related story in this issue). A big thanks to Art Angel member Jeni Bate!
NAWA’s first printmaking media exhibition in recent memory is up at the prestigious Center for Contemporary Printmaking in Norwalk, Connecticut through March 28.
Coming soon: the historic exhibit, “She the People,” opening in April and running through July 2026, commemorating the 250th anniversary of the signing of the Declaration of Independence; the NAWA Annual Members’ Exhibit, returning to the Leonovich Gallery in the Chelsea neighborhood in New York City; and, the repeating Flushing Bank, Aloft Hotel, Summer Small Works exhibitions.
